文章目录一、微信支付接入与介绍1、微信支付产品介绍2、接入指引二、支付安全基础(证书/**秘钥**/**签名)**1、安全基础2、**对称加密和非对称加密**3、摘要算法4、数字签名与证书4.1 数字签名4.2 数字证书4.3 **https协议中的数字证书**三、基础支付API V31、支付配置准备1.1 引入支付参数1.2 加载商户私钥1.3 **获取签名验证器和HttpClient**1.
转载
2023-11-15 15:12:49
22阅读
1、支付宝这里首先肯定是申请好支付宝支付功能和商户ID等等信息,然后给到后台配置。 支付宝官方demo中目前有2种调起方式:原生调起,H5调起 1.如果你的项目是原生APP,那么项目组的后台接入支付宝SDK后会返回给客户端一串超长的字符串: 比如alipay_root_cert_sn=6879rjofjosjfoiwjfw7dddf3d3b83462e1dfcf6&app_cert_sn=
1.微信公众号支付 流程:拼接授权url,然后将授权的redirectUrl定义为含有微信预下单支付等的方法内(1)授权 在拼接授权url时将相关的预下单所需的参数一并拿到,然后redirect至redirectURL业务处理 (2)统一下单 拿到上一步传递来的参数,调用微信统一下单API。除被扫支付场景以外,商户系统先调用该接口在微信支付服务后台生成预支付交易单,返回正确的预支付交易回话
转载
2024-08-17 12:09:16
91阅读
视频和代码都在里面了,另外还送大家两本书,想要资料的联系博主免费赠送哦!
原创
2022-03-03 11:06:51
204阅读
在现代移动支付环境中,接入微信与支付宝支付功能是大多数安卓应用的重要需求。这篇博文将详细探讨“android 微信支付宝支付接入”的各个方面,包括版本对比、迁移指南、兼容性处理、实战案例、排错指南以及生态扩展。希望通过这篇文章帮助开发者顺利接入这两大支付平台。
## 版本对比
在接入微信与支付宝支付前,需要理解两个平台在特性上的差异。以下是主要特性比较:
| 特性 | 微信
###本文问主要介绍接入支付宝支付中服务端的代码集成过程,运用的开发工具为VS(Visual Studio)。(官网说明文档) ####一、 集成服务端支付宝SDK (1) 官方下载SDK,根据自己服务端的开发语言选择相应的SDK,我的就用C#。下载完之后解压 (2) 设置NuGet程序包源。在VS ...
转载
2021-08-02 17:58:00
363阅读
2评论
不可否认,移动支付如今已经渗透到人们日常生活的方方面面。因此,如何在抓住机会,获取更多用户。中国银联、支付宝、微信支付三国鼎立时代,三者分别有怎样的优势?一、中国银联银联是以银行卡为依托的,银联的历史较为悠久,由于四方卡组织模式,银联其实并不像支付宝、微信支付那样掌握用户;而且银联的布局比较晚,现在目前移动支付几乎是支付宝与微信的天下,银联面临的竞争也是很大的,但是银联的优势也是很大的,在手续费方
转载
2023-10-27 22:47:50
5阅读
1、微信支付 以下是微信支付交互时序图,统一下单API、支付结果通知API和查询订单API等都涉及签名过程,调用都必须在商户服务器端完成。如图1所示 商户系统和微信支付系统主要交互说明:步骤1:用户在商户APP中选择商品,提交订单,选择微信支付。步骤2:商户后台收到用户支付单,调用微信支付统一下单接口。步骤3:统一下单接口返回正常的prepay_id,再按签名规范重新生成签名后,将数据传输给APP
转载
2023-09-27 08:22:55
145阅读
本文使用的是调起app支付,而且使用的请求参数及其格式校正,已经在后端完成本文使用的是调起app支付,而且使用的请求参数及其格式校正,已经在后端完成本文使用的是调起app支付,而且使用的请求参数及其格式校正,已经在后端完成sdk版本为v15.5.5,androidStudio版本为2.3.2 后续简称as去官网上下载带有demo的sdk:https://docs.open.alipay.com/5
转载
2024-02-25 12:24:04
684阅读
1.申请商户API证书APIv2 中,调用微信支付安全级别较高的接口(如:退款、企业红包、企业付款)APIv3 中,调用微信支付所有接口2.商户申请商户API证书时,会生成商户私钥,并保存在本地证书文件夹的文件apiclient_key.pem 中。私钥也可以通过工具从商户的p12证书中导出。请妥善保管好你的商户私钥文件。3.平台证书微信支付平台证书是指由微信支付 负责申请的,
转载
2023-11-21 17:19:41
108阅读
# 实现支付宝Java服务端
## 概述
在实现支付宝Java服务端之前,我们首先需要了解整个流程。下面是实现支付宝Java服务端的大致流程:
| 步骤 | 描述 |
| ------------ | ------------ |
| 1. 创建应用 | 在支付宝开放平台上创建应用,并获取应用的AppID和私钥。 |
| 2. 配置回调地址 | 配置应用的回调地址,用于接收支付宝的异步通知。
原创
2023-08-09 14:16:41
49阅读
今天在尝试使用支付宝接入,遇到了一些问题。这里我把使用的过程,以及接入过程中遇到的问题记录一下。首先就是登录蚂蚁金服官方网站:https://open.alipay.com/platform/home.htm进入网页&移动应用列表: 创建应用-》支付接入: 创建完以后需要审批,大概需要1个工作日的时间。 我主要是想使用pc上支付的功能,所以需要添加电脑网站支付
转载
2024-08-13 15:55:08
63阅读
前言很多APP都需要支付功能,国内一般就是支付宝和微信了。目前这2种接入方式对于APP端来说都已经比较方便了,因为大部分的安全校验之类的逻辑都在服务端。
APP端总结起来就是三步走:
接入支付的库接受服务端的订单信息,发起调用支付宝和微信接收支付宝和微信的回调支付宝接入首先是接入支付宝的aar文件比较坑的是支付宝还需要下载aar文件导入,而不是gradle里面一行依赖就能搞定的。
我们需要去官网下
转载
2019-06-14 09:03:00
142阅读
前言很多APP都需要支付功能,国内一般就是支付宝和微信了。目前这2种接入方式对于APP端来说都已经比较方便了,因为大部分的安全校验之类的逻辑都在服务端。
APP端总结起来就是三步走:
接入支付的库接受服务端的订单信息,发起调用支付宝和微信接收支付宝和微信的回调支付宝接入首先是接入支付宝的aar文件比较坑的是支付宝还需要下载aar文件导入,而不是gradle里面一行依赖就能搞定的。
我们需要去官网下
转载
2019-06-10 09:07:00
189阅读
对支付宝的“标准快速付款接口文档”“即时到账接口开发文档及其代码实例”“net_05_UTF-8(post方式)”“解读支付宝接口程序”进行汇总和整理,希望能够帮助需要的朋友。
最近需要为网站加入支付宝的充值接口,而目前关于支付宝接口开发的资料比较杂乱,这里就我此次开发所用到的资料进行汇总整理,希望能够帮助需要的朋友。开发步骤:1. 确定签约类型支付宝的
转载
2023-05-30 22:26:00
110阅读
支付基本上是很多产品都必须的一个模块,大家最熟悉的应该就是微信和支付宝支付了,不过更多的可能还是停留在直接sdk的调用上,甚至和业务系统高度耦合,网上也存在各种解决方案,但大多形式各异,东拼西凑而成。所以这里我介绍下OSS.PayCenter开源跨平台支付组件 及其框架设计。并对常用支付模式进行一个全面介绍,方便大家开发以及跨平台使用。这篇文章主要围绕以下几个模块:1. 微信和支付宝对比2.
转载
2023-09-13 18:24:18
37阅读
文档中心:https://doc.open.alipay.com/点右上角的进入文档中心使用的你的支付宝账号登录 ,实名认证后点 开放者中心 -沙箱应用生成商户应用公钥和私钥https://doc.open.alipay.com/docs/doc.htm?treeId=291&articleId=105971&docType=1生成后会保存在本地
转载
2022-04-13 11:24:53
420阅读
参考:微信支付API:https://pay.weixin.qq.com/wiki/doc/api/app/app.php?chapter=8_1支付宝API:https://doc.open.alipay.com/docs/doc.htm?spm=a219a.7629140.0.0.q4Kj5i&treeId=193&articleId=105051&docType=1&
苹果iOS12捷径扫码付款怎么设置 微信支付宝扫码二合一支付捷径。捷径是苹果手机一个比较实用的功能,如今手机扫码支付非常流行,因此在苹果手机中安装一个支付捷径,还是非常方便的。下面小编就来分享一个微信、支付宝、Apple Pay四合一扫码付款捷径给大家,希望对大家有所帮助,一直来看一下具体的操作步骤。苹果iOS12捷径扫码付款怎么设置微信支付宝四合一扫码付款捷径安装方法:1、先在 App Stor
转载
2023-07-13 19:29:35
34阅读
## 实现 Java 微信支付宝支付的步骤
### 概述
本文将指导你如何实现 Java 微信支付宝支付,首先我们会了解整个支付流程,然后逐步介绍每个步骤需要做什么以及所需代码。
### 支付流程
下表展示了实现 Java 微信支付宝支付的整个流程: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建支付请求 |
| 2 | 发起支付请求 |
| 3 | 处理支付结果
原创
2024-01-16 10:33:03
83阅读